Why Training Matters in Robotic-Assisted Surgery
Robotic-assisted knee surgery is more than just operating a machine—it demands expertise in surgical planning, precise alignment, and critical decision-making. Orthopedic surgeons who want to perform the best robotic knee replacement must receive proper hands-on experience.
Unlike theoretical learning, practical exposure to robotic knee surgery at a high-volume center like Duke allows surgeons to:
Gain confidence with real patient cases
Learn optimal implant positioning
Understand navigation, soft-tissue balancing, and patient-specific planning
See faster results with fewer complications
Training with advanced robotic systems ensures you’re equipped to meet rising patient expectations and compete in the evolving landscape of knee replacement robotic surgery.
